PHOENIX Medical Supplies Ltd. is looking for a dedicated Healthcare Partner to join our pharmacy team in Liverpool. This role offers an opportunity to positively impact patients' lives while advancing your career.
Candidates must hold an NVQ2 in Pharmacy Services and a Medicine Counter Assistant qualification. The job involves building relationships with customers and ensuring the delivery of pharmacy services. A supportive work environment and ongoing training are provided.

How to prepare for a job interview at PHOENIX Medical Supplies Ltd.
✨Know Your Qualifications Inside Out
Make sure you’re familiar with your NVQ2 in Pharmacy Services and Medicine Counter Assistant qualification. Be ready to discuss how your training has prepared you for the role and give examples of how you've applied your knowledge in real-life situations.
✨Showcase Your People Skills
As a Healthcare Partner, building relationships with customers is key. Prepare some anecdotes that highlight your experience in customer service or teamwork. Think about times when you’ve positively impacted someone’s experience in a pharmacy setting.
✨Research PHOENIX Medical Supplies Ltd.
Take some time to learn about PHOENIX Medical Supplies Ltd. and their values. Understanding their mission and how they support their staff will help you align your answers with what they’re looking for, showing that you’re genuinely interested in being part of their team.
✨Prepare Questions to Ask
Interviews are a two-way street! Prepare thoughtful questions about the role, the team, and the ongoing training opportunities. This shows that you’re engaged and serious about your potential future with them.
